Understanding Midget Faded Rattlesnakes: A Brief Overview

Midget Faded Rattlesnakes, also known as Western Rattlesnakes, are a small venomous snake species found in the western United States. They are known for their muted coloration, which helps them blend into their natural environment. These rattlesnakes typically grow to about two feet in length and are relatively docile compared to their larger rattlesnake counterparts. However, it’s important to note that they still possess venom and should be handled with caution.

Benefits of Bioactive Enclosures for Midget Faded Rattlesnakes

Bioactive enclosures offer numerous benefits for Midget Faded Rattlesnakes. Firstly, they allow the snakes to exhibit natural behaviors such as burrowing, climbing, and hunting. This promotes mental and physical stimulation, leading to a healthier and more content snake. Additionally, the bioactive setup helps maintain a more stable and natural environment, which can positively impact the overall well-being of the snake. The presence of live plants also improves air quality and provides hiding spots, further enhancing the snake’s sense of security.

Choosing the Right Substrate for a Bioactive Enclosure

Selecting the appropriate substrate is crucial for maintaining a healthy bioactive enclosure for Midget Faded Rattlesnakes. A mix of organic materials such as coconut coir, sphagnum moss, and soil can be used to create a naturalistic and moisture-retaining substrate. This will help mimic the snake’s natural habitat and aid in maintaining proper humidity levels. It’s important to avoid substrates that can cause harm, such as cedar or pine, as these can release toxic chemicals.

Providing Adequate Hiding Spots for Midget Faded Rattlesnakes

Midget Faded Rattlesnakes require hiding spots to feel secure and reduce stress. In a bioactive enclosure, providing a variety of hiding spots is essential. These can include rock caves, hollow logs, or purpose-built hides. Live plants can also serve as hiding spots, offering the snake a sense of security while still maintaining a natural aesthetic.

Temperature and Humidity Requirements for Bioactive Enclosures

Maintaining appropriate temperature and humidity levels is crucial for the health of Midget Faded Rattlesnakes. The enclosure should have a thermal gradient, with a warm side ranging from 85-90°F (29-32°C) and a cooler side around 70-75°F (21-24°C). A basking spot should also be provided, reaching temperatures of 90-95°F (32-35°C). Humidity levels should be maintained between 40-60%, with occasional misting or a humidity box provided to aid shedding.

Feeding Midget Faded Rattlesnakes in a Bioactive Environment

Feeding Midget Faded Rattlesnakes in a bioactive enclosure can be done by offering appropriately sized prey items. These snakes typically consume rodents, such as mice or small rats. It’s important to ensure the prey is of appropriate size to prevent regurgitation or choking hazards. Feeding should take place in a separate enclosure to avoid ingesting substrate during mealtime.

Maintaining Cleanliness in Bioactive Enclosures for Midget Faded Rattlesnakes

One of the advantages of a bioactive enclosure is its self-cleaning nature. The presence of beneficial microorganisms and invertebrates, such as springtails and isopods, helps break down waste materials. However, spot cleaning should still be performed regularly to remove any visible waste. It’s also essential to monitor the health of the bioactive ecosystem and make adjustments as needed.

Monitoring Health and Behavior in Bioactive Enclosures

Regular monitoring of the Midget Faded Rattlesnake’s health and behavior is crucial in a bioactive enclosure. Observing feeding response, shedding, and defecation patterns can provide insight into the snake’s well-being. Additionally, maintaining accurate records of weight, length, and any changes in behavior can help identify potential health issues early on.
